Description:

Royal Sovereign 4-Row Digital Automatic Electronic Coin Sorter

Features:

The Royal Sovereign FS-4000 automatic 4-row digital coin sorter quickly and accurately sorts 312 coins per minute.


Coin tubes automatically adjust to fill the next empty tube allowing for hands-free operation.


The collection opening holds up to 600 coins. Anti-jamming device allows coins to be sorted accurately.


The LCD display shows the amount and dollar value of the coins sorted.


Easily open cover to remove unsortable coins. Coin tubes and starter coin wrappers included.

Its ok. for the amount that I paid for it ($100, the retail is like $275 so I THOUGHT I got a deal) I wish it worked better. It Jams, but I couldnt blame the machine itself. There were some pennies that were stuck together for some reason. But there were times were I would walk away, and come back to find pennies all over the place, like the machine had some difficulty sorting them, but they slipped though the "gate" and just started "spilling" out. So I had to clean that mess up a few times. Also the thing just reset to zero without me touching it. I was sorting a lot of coins, and I dont know if it got to 999.99 or what, but next thing I know the thing stops and the counts are all zero, and there is nothing in the total tally. So that was annoying. The whole reason I spent that much was to count my money
now Im going to have to count the rolls by hand. I also have to check the rolls for too many or too little coins. I haven't seen much contamination (I did see one penny roll with a dime in it). But I have found a few penny rolls 1 penny short, which maybe in the grand scheme of things doesn't really matter, but I am counting change here. The Quaters sorted flawlessly, Dimes were next in terms of flawlessness, Nickles, had a few mishaps, and you know about the pennies. There is no Dollar coin slot which I kind of wish there were, but I only had 24 dollar coins so maybe it probably wouldn't have even filled up a sleeve. There is NO OVER FLOW basin. So when there is a Jam, you have to take the coins out open up the apparatus and take the jamming coin out. The Jams did not break the machine though which I imagine for the cheaper machines, might be the case. Anyways, I got my coins sorted, possibly over 1000$ worth (half a 5 gallon jug), although I don't really know because the thing reset!!! the last count I tallied totaled $884.89 then after the reset It counted $41)

This was my husband's Christmas present. I thought I had found the perfect gift! He spent 2 or 3 hours trying to wrap coins. It jammed so much that he spent more time unjamming it than he spent wrapping coins. It is very difficult to get the coins out once it has jammed. We packed it up the same day to send it back. I wound up buying hand sorting trays and wrappers for much less money. It was actually faster and less aggravating to wrap the change this way than to keep unjamming the electronic sorter. How much does one have to pay for a sorter to actually have it work? I would have thought that $140 for an electric coin sorter should have been enough. This thing retails for about $300.
